Have recently upgraded to XP. When displaying folder contents in My Music
tracks do not show in strict alphabetical order, e.g. "The Shadows - Third
Man" is shown before "The Shadows - Deer Hunter" the layout of the titles are
identical - no spaces missed etc. - so why do they no longer list in true
alphabetical order and how can I change this.

Did you try right click into this folder, and select "Arrange icons by:
Name" in the menu?

Thanks - I had already selected "arrange icons by: name" in the menu but it
did not appear to make any difference. However after closing down pc
altogether and restarting the problem was solved!
